Learn about the different preparation services available for inventory that you send to Amazon fulfilment centres and their associated fee.
You can use the Preparation service to have Amazon properly package and prep your products for fulfilment.
FBA has Packaging and Prep Requirements for products you ship to and store in Amazon fulfilment centres. Properly packaging and preparing units helps to reduce delays in receive time, to protect your products while at our fulfilment centres and to create a better customer experience.
If you decide to use the Preparation service, Amazon will prepare your eligible products for a per-unit fee. To have Amazon prepare your products, you must first enable Preparation services. When you send inventory to our fulfilment centres, you will be able to select whether your products will be prepared by Amazon or by you. When building your Shipping Plan, we will provide an estimate of the FBA Preparation Fees based on the expected preparation services for the selected products.

Once you have enabled the Preparation service, you will be able to select whether Amazon or you will prep each eligible product by following the steps below on the Prepare Products page of your Shipping Plan.
You can also choose who preps your products by default on your FBA settings page. Note that changing the default does not affect previously created shipments or any prep preferences you have defined for specific items.
For each eligible product listed on the Prepare Products page of the shipping workflow, under "Who preps?" select "Amazon" if you want Amazon to prep the product or select "Seller" if you want to prep the product yourself. "Amazon" will be the default selection for products with Prep Guidance.
Products without Prep Guidance may still have packaging and prep requirements. For products without Prep Guidance, "Choose category" will appear in the Prep Guidance column. In order for Amazon to prep these products, you must follow these steps:
If you do not take these actions, or select "Seller" in the "Who preps?" column, then you will be responsible for preparing these products.
* See the Preparation Matrix for descriptions of prep categories and related prep activities. To learn more, visit Packaging and Preparation Requirements.
After determining who preps the products, you can select whether Amazon or you will be responsible for applying labels to each unit on the Label Product page of your Shipping Plan.

Per Unit Fee | Standard-Size | Oversize | ||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Preparation Category | Prep | Labelling | Total | Prep | Labelling | Total |
Fragile/Glass
|
£0.40 | £0.15 | £0.55 | £0.80 | £0.15 | £0.95 |
Liquids
|
£0.25 | £0.15* | £0.25 - £0.40 | £0.50 | £0.15* | £0.50 - £0.65 |
Clothing, Fabric, Plush and Textiles
|
£0.25 | £0.15* | £0.25 - £0.40 | £0.50 | £0.15* | £0.50 - £0.65 |
Baby Products
|
£0.25 | £0.15* | £0.25 - £0.40 | £0.50 | £0.15* | £0.50 - £0.65 |
Small
|
£0.25 | £0.15 | £0.40 | n/a | n/a | n/a |
*Label Service Optional. All products must have a scannable label that will be visible after prep is complete.
